氮营养水平对烤烟根际土壤酶活性及烟叶内在品质的影响

摘    要:田间试验研究了不同时期烤烟根际各土层土壤酶活性变化规律及其不同施氮量对烟叶品质的影响。结果表明:0~20 cm土层范围内,施氮可以提高圆顶期、采烤期及采烤结束后土壤脲酶、转化酶的活性,但当施氮量超过52.5 kg hm-2时,脲酶、转化酶的活性反而降低;土壤蛋白酶活性均在37.5 kg hm-2处理达到最大值,且随着施氮量的增多大都呈现降低的趋势。20~80 cm土层范围内,土壤脲酶、转化酶、蛋白酶活性变化规律并不一致。对于烤后烟叶,施氮量为52.5 kg hm-2的烟叶,糖碱比、氮碱比、钾氯比均比较适宜,化学成分较为协调,燃烧性较好,有利于优质烟叶品质的形成。说明在该地区的试验条件下,水稻土种植烤烟最适宜的施氮量为52.5 kg hm-2。

Effects of Nitrogen Fertilizer on Tobacco Soil Enzyme Activities and Flue-cured Tobacco Immanent Quality

Abstract:The field experiment was conducted on planting tobacco soil to research variation rules of soil enzyme activities in different soil layers at different stages and to research the effects of different nitrogen levels on tobacco quality.The results showed that at 0-20 cm soil depth,the N application was helpful to increase the activities of soil urease,invertase.When the N applied was over 52.5 kg hm-2,the activities of soil urease,invertase were decreased.The activities of soil protease reached its maximum when the N applied was 37.5 kg hm-2,along with the N of going up,the activities of soil protease presented a trend of decreasing.At 20-80 cm soil depth,the variation laws of the activities of soil urease,invertase,protease were inconsistent.To the flue-cured tobacco,when the N applied was at 52.5 kg hm-2,the ratio of total sugar to nicotine,total nitrogen to nicotine and potassium to chlorine were more appropriate,the chemical composition tended to coordinate and burning performance was much better,and it had still helped to form excellent quality of flue-cured tobacco.It also indicated that 52.5 kg N per hectare was the most proper nitrogen in the paddy soil under the experimental condition.
